expliquer ce programme:surtout les symbole "%-","%f","%"
Ecrire la suite d’instructions python qui lit le prix HT d’un article, le nombre d’articles et le taux de TVA, et qui fournit le prix total TTC correspondant. Faire en sorte que des libell´es apparaissent clairement.
Marsh Posté le 26-01-2009 à 09:43:16
expliquer ce programme:surtout les symbole "%-","%f","%"
Ecrire la suite d’instructions python qui lit le prix HT d’un article, le nombre d’articles et le taux
de TVA, et qui fournit le prix total TTC correspondant. Faire en sorte que des libell´es apparaissent
clairement.
labelPu = "prix unitaire"
labelQte = "quantité"
labelTva = "TVA"
labelTotal = "Total"
lgMax = len(labelPu)
sep = "-"*(lgMax+2)
format = "%-"+ str(lgMax) + "s"
pu = input((format + " : " ) % labelPu)
qte = input((format + " : " ) % labelQte)
tva = input((format + " : " ) % labelTva)
if tva > 1:
tva = tva / 100.0
total = pu * qte * (1.0 + tva)
print sep
print (format + " : %f" ) % (labelTotal,total)